Abstract
We describe the design and fabrication of a photonic bandgap fiber formed with two different glasses. As in a hollow-core fiber, light is guided in a low-index core region because of the antiresonances of the high-index strands in the fiber cladding. The structure described represents an ideal bandgap fiber that exhibits no interface modes and guides over the full width of multiple bandgaps.
